It’s common for male cats to act crazy after getting fixed due to hormonal changes. The procedure can cause stress and temporary behavioral shifts as their bodies adjust. Provide a calm, comfortable environment with distractions like toys. If erratic behavior persists beyond a few weeks, consult your vet as there could be other underlying issues.

- Is it normal for male cats to act hyperactive after neutering? Yes, it is common for male cats to display hyperactive or erratic behavior shortly after neutering due to hormonal changes and stress from the procedure.
- How long does it take for a male cat's behavior to stabilize after being fixed? Most male cats' behavior begins to normalize within a few weeks after neutering, as their hormones and stress levels settle.
- What should I do if my neutered male cat continues acting crazy for weeks? If erratic behavior persists beyond a few weeks, consult your veterinarian to rule out underlying health issues or complications.
- How can I help my male cat adjust after neutering? Provide a calm, comfortable environment with distractions like toys and minimize stress to support your cat’s adjustment post-neutering.
